- Rikugi Garden is located in Hon-Komagome[3].
- Rikugi Garden is in the country of Japan[4].
- Rikugi Garden's instance of is recorded as Tokyo metropolitan park[5].
- Rikugi Garden's instance of is recorded as daimyo garden[6].
- Rikugi Garden's founder is recorded as Yanagisawa Yoshiyasu[7].
- Rikugi Garden is owned by Iwasaki Yatarō[8].
- Rikugi Garden is owned by Tokyo[9].
- Rikugi Garden is operated by Tokyo Metropolitan Park Association[10].

- Rikugi Garden comprises Chidori Bridge[13].
- 1702 marks the founding of Rikugi Garden[14].

- Rikugi Garden's heritage designation is recorded as Place of Scenic Beauty[24].
- Rikugi Garden's heritage designation is recorded as Special Place of Scenic Beauty[25].
- Rikugi Garden's date of official opening is recorded as October 16, 1938[26].
